So I am trying to get an AI in movement, but when I try to test the path he will be moving, I used the following script as the first line, and its giving me error.
start = game:GetService("PathfindService"):ComputeRawPathAsync(game.Workspace.Start.Position.game.Workspace.Finish.Position,500)
for whatever reason, when I try to test the path status, it tells me error, and when I ran the game, it says "PathfindService" is not a real service.
Help? |

"PathfindService"
It's PathfindingService

Ok, that seemed to work.
Do you know what I can type in the output to check if the path is a success

pathfindingService = game:GetService("PathfindingService") local path = pathfindingService:ComputeRawPathAsync(workspace.Start.Position, workspace.Finish.Position,500) print(path.Status)
